Главная » Файлы » Как создать сайт » На WordPress |
27.01.2018, 19:12 | |
Способа создания контактной формы есть как минимум два: написать код самостоятельно (и это сложнее) либо выбрать один из множества специализированных плагинов (что быстрей и проще). Мы пойдём лёгким путём, а в качестве плагина выберем Contact Form 7. Это расширение отличает популярность (больше миллиона установок) и высокий рейтинг (4,5 из 5 и почти тысяча проголосовавших). Вставляем форму1. В админ-панели WordPress откройте Плагины -> Добавить новый. 2. В поле поиска введите Contact Form 7 и в блоке плагина нажмите кнопку Установить. 3. Дождитесь завершения установки (подробнее о ней читайте здесь) и щёлкните ссылку Активировать плагин. 4. В главном меню панели управления WordPress появился пункт Contact Form 7 с тремя подпунктами. Щёлкните Contact Form 7 -> Формы и скопируйте код вставки ([contact-form-7 id="46" title="Контактная форма 1"]). 5. Откройте для редактирования или создайте страницу, на которой должна находиться контактная форма, переключите редактор в режим Текст, вставьте код и сохраните изменения. 6. Посмотрите, как будет выглядеть ваша форма. На странице Contact Form 7 вы можете изменять количество и название полей формы, настраивать формат письма, которое будет приходить на e-mail после нажатия кнопки Отправить, изменять адрес, на который оно будет приходить, задавать другие параметры, а также добавлять новые формы и делать их копии. Защищаем контактную формуЛюбую форму нужно защищать от роботов, иначе на почту будет приходить масса спама. Contact Form 7 поддерживает интеграцию с reCAPTCHA — разработкой Google, позволяющей защитить форму от спама, не заставляя пользователя при этом вводить цифры, решать примеры или набирать непонятный текст — для идентификации людям будет достаточно установить флажок с текстом вроде «Я не робот». Для защиты с помощью reCAPTCHA вам нужно перейти на сайт сервиса, зарегистрировать там свой ресурс, получить ключи и добавить тег reCAPTCHA на страницу контактной формы. | |
Просмотров: 374 | Загрузок: 0 | |
Всего комментариев: 0 | |